Publisher's Synopsis

This easy-to-read book discusses how the typical learning centers in preschool classrooms - blocks, pretend play, music, reading, art, and others - can be adapted for children with special needs. As with the first edition, the author explains the importance of play as a medium for learning and describes ways to teach general and specific learning objectives through the informal use of toys and classroom materials. Included in the book are sample activities, two chapters on how to help children learn to play in groups and make friends, and play checklists. This completely revised and updated edition contains a new chapter on emergent literacy and new information on the role of physical and occupational therapists in supporting children with special needs.
